Purpose and Function in Audi A6 C8 Suspension
The front lower left control arm in the Audi A6 C8 is responsible for precise wheel guidance relative to the body and maintaining the stable position of the hub during suspension operation. This component transfers loads resulting from acceleration, braking, and driving over uneven surfaces, and also influences wheel camber and toe angles. A correctly selected control arm allows for the preservation of factory handling parameters, which translates to predictable steering system responses and driving comfort.

Vehicle Placement and Installation Aspects
The presented control arm is intended for installation in the front left part of the suspension. This clear designation of placement simplifies the selection of the correct component when replacing a single part or after collision repair. Installation is performed at the standard mounting points provided by the vehicle manufacturer, allowing for servicing without additional adaptations.
After installation, a wheel alignment is recommended to fully utilize the properties of the new component and ensure even tire wear. A correctly installed control arm supports driving stability, reduces unwanted vibrations, and improves driving comfort.
